Early Childhood Assistant Teacher
Trinity Episcopal School
Posted 09/23/24
1315 Jackson Avenue, New Orleans, LA 70130
Job Description
Trinity Episcopal School is an early childhood through Eighth Grade co-educational school located in the Garden District. Trinity Episcopal School’s mission is to build confident, resilient upstanders on a foundation of academic excellence, moral responsibility, and faith who are prepared to make a positive difference in the world. We offer a challenging curriculum that applies the latest and best educational practices, fostering our students' intellectual, spiritual, moral, and physical development within a creative and nurturing learning environment.
Trinity Episcopal School in New Orleans, Louisiana, is searching for a full time Assistant Teacher in our Les Enfants Division. The classrooms have some of our youngest learners; we expect our staff to be aware of the needs of children from approximately 15 months through four years of age. The successful candidates would be expected to work with young children, their families, and other faculty/staff members in an ethical and responsible manner both on campus and in the community. A degree in Early Childhood Education and classroom experience in a similar setting are preferred. We are laying the foundation for upstanders who are gentle, generous, truthful, kind, and brave.
Working at Trinity Episcopal School is deeply rewarding. Our dedicated faculty and staff work hard to foster a supportive, caring, and collegial work culture. We seek to hire faculty and staff committed to excellence and a commitment to providing every child with a safe and loving school community. Trinity Episcopal School offers a benefits package designed to provide for the well-being of its employees and their families. Benefits for full-time employees include health, dental, vision, life, and disability insurance; competitive compensation and retirement benefits; paid personal and sick leave, tuition remission, and a myriad of professional development opportunities.
